John Snow, Inc., and our nonprofit JSI Research & Training Institute, Inc., are public health management consulting and research organizations dedicated to improving the health of individuals and communities throughout the world. JSI's mission is to improve the health of underserved people and communities and to provide a place where people of passion and commitment can pursue this cause. For 35 years, Boston-based JSI and our affiliates have provided high-quality technical and managerial assistance to public health programs worldwide. JSI has implemented projects in 106 countries, and currently operates from eight U.S. and 81 international offices, with more than 500 U.S.-based professionals and 1,600 host country staff. JSI is deeply committed to improving the health of individuals and communities worldwide. We work in partnership with governments, organizations, and host-country experts to improve quality, access and equity of health systems worldwide. We collaborate with government agencies, the private sector, and local nonprofit and civil society organizations to achieve change in communities and health systems.

Position Summary

  • The Data Analytics and Visualization Program Associate is responsible for designing and implementing a strategic vision for electronic systems to analyze, report, visualize, and disseminate program data.
  • S/he will work closely with the Senior MEAL Advisor and project team to implement innovative data visualization tools tailored to country-specific needs.

Major Accountabilities

  • Working in close coordination with the Senior MEAL Advisor and other technical leads, manages the development and execution of a roadmap for new and/or existing applications or initiatives to support data management, analysis, visualization, and use.
  • Oversees the creation and dissemination of analytic tools including user-friendly front-end interfaces, automated routinely generated reports, queries, and analytic datasets to the project team, the donor, ministries of health (MOH), and key stakeholders.
  • Advises on data management systems security and compliance with national guidelines.
  • Leads efforts to develop robust, user-friendly, high-quality interfaces for data visualization.
  • Supports increased data use across the project for program monitoring and evaluation.
  • Supports preparation of regular and ad hoc data products.
  • Collaborates with and supports requests to examine data in key content areas.
  • Lead analysis for program M&E using routinely collected service delivery data.
  • Generate summary reports for reporting and program M&E.
  • Develop a curriculum and implement analysis training(s) for MRITE staff and partners.
  • Oversees the creation and maintenance of codebooks, user guides, documentation, and standard operating procedures (SOPs) as needed for project strategic information (SI) systems.
  • Proactively maintains knowledge of recent developments such as “big data” analytics applications and data visualization.
  • Perform other related duties as required.

Requirements

Educational Qualification:

  • A First Degree in Public Health, Demography, Statistics, Computer Science, Information Management, or a related discipline.
  • An advanced degree is an added advantage.

Experience, Skills, and Other Requirements:

  • 2-4 years of experience managing and analyzing large data sets and experience with advanced statistical analysis.
  • Demonstrated experience working with SPSS, SQL, STATA, and Microsoft Office Applications.
  • Demonstrated experience working with Geo-special analysis tools, e.g. QGIS, and ArcGIS.
  • Demonstrated experience with Thinkcell, PowerBi or Tableau.
  • Experience in the design, implementation, and management of health monitoring and evaluation systems in low-resource settings.
  • Excellent English verbal and written communication skills.
